Karuk Tribal Members Discuss Practice of Prescribed Burns

Oct 24, 2018 — For another look at forest health, our friends at KMUD News recently spent the afternoon in Karuk tribal lands on the northeast edge of Humboldt County during an interagency collaboration on prescribed burns among CalFire, the US Forest Service, and tribal members. Lauren Schmitt reports on some of the stories and traditions of the Karuk practice of burning in the forest to benefit people, plants, and wildlife.
